Qatar to participate in Arab Shotgun Championship

DOHA: The Nasser bin Saleh Al Attiyah-led Qatar team left for the Arab Shotgun Championship, which is taking place in Rabat Morocco.

Attiyah, a former Olympic Games skeet bronze medallist and triple Asia champion, is one of the 14 members representing Qatar.

Qatar Shooting and Archery Association Secretary-General Majid Al Naimi is the head of the squad and Al Anoud al Naimi is the administration manager.

The participating teams are: Kuwait, Oman, Bahrain, the United Arab Emirates, Saudi Arabia, Egypt, Algeria, Lebanon, Iraq, Libya, Palestine and hosts Morocco.
